			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>What do the torque setting on a drill mean</strong>?</p>
<p><a href="http://toolsblog.tool-deals.com/wp-content/uploads/cc/power_tools36.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-77" style="border: 0pt none; margin: 5px;" title="torque settings on a drill" src="http://toolsblog.tool-deals.com/wp-content/uploads/cc/power_tools36.jpg" alt="cordless drill" width="125" height="125" /></a>We get this question quite a bit. Most people are confused about the torque feature on most electric and cordless drills. In a nutshell, these torque setting represent varying degrees of power. Think of them as a power setting for your drill. The higher the number, the more power.</p>
<p>Well, it sounds like all you need to do is just set the drill to the highest power setting and forget about it, doesn't it? Nothing could be further from the truth. There's a reason they put those torque setting on a drill! It's not some useless feature on your <a title="power tool" href="http://tool-deals.com/power-tools">power tools</a>!</p>
<p>For one thing, when you set the torque setting to a lower setting, it will stop or make that "clickity, clickity, clickity" sound. This means you've reached the maximum torque for that setting. This comes in useful for preventing over stripping of a screw or over-tightening a nut on a bolt.</p>
<p>If you are using the drill to drive deck screws into a deck, then you would probably need the highest setting. You can also use the lower setting to drive screws flush with the surface of the wood. Once you find the perfect setting so that the drill stops when the head is flush with the wood surface, your job will become faster and faster!</p>
<p>So now that you know what the torque settings on a drill mean, go out and experiment with it. You'll find you'll become more accurate and your jobs look more professional!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Question:</strong> Can you give me a suggestions on <strong>buying a replacement power tools battery</strong>, as my battery died and I have to buy another battery.</p>
<p><strong>Answer: </strong>Normally you have several options when it comes to <em>buying replacement batteries for power tools</em>. For others, not so much. You're tied to the manufacturers replacement battery for your <a title="power tools" href="http://tool-deals.com/power-tools">power tool</a>.</p>
<p>For example, there are some pretty good Chinese knockoffs of Dewalt and Makita cordless power tool batteries. No if you use them and something goes wrong, most of the time these manufacturers will not honor the warranty. You must be using the companies replacement battery or the original battery that came with the power tool. But if your cordless tool is not under any warranty and you want to buy a cheaper replacement battery for your cordless too, then feelf ree to go ahead and give it a try. You may find that these cheaper batteries are just as good as the big name companies batteries!</p>

<p>Want more features? The compound miter saw has 9 positive stops at 15, 22.5, 31.6, 45 degrees left or right and at 0 degrees for shifting among the common cutting angles in a jiffy. For finer bevel cuts this Makita miter saw features positive bevel stops at 33.9 degree and 45 degree left and right. A user need not assume the common angles to stop for bevel cut; the saw does that by itself. This tool can work under pressure and still successfully maintain its constant speed with the incorporated electronic speed control. For additional convenience there is a built-in wrench in its single aluminum case. Makita LS1214FL's versatility can be judged by long slide track, wide pivot angle, large turn base, and adjustable pivot fence that can handle almost all type of material and application. Baseboard trim, crown molding or any project that includes complicated angles, you can now do them all and have them fit perfectly with the <em>Makita LS1214FL</em>.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h3>Miter Saws: How To Choose The Right One For You</h3>
<p>The Miter Saw is a really useful tool in many workshops. They can make the miter cuts as their name implies, and bevel cuts, compound cuts, and crosscuts as well. If you have a lot of cutting to do, the speed at which they make these cuts is a godsend. If you are looking into getting one for yourself, here is <strong>how to choose a Miter Saw</strong> that is right for your jobs.</p>
<p>First and foremost, you need to figure out which types of cuts you will be making. If you are satisfied with simply cutting straight down in plain miter or crosscuts, then you will be happy with a simple, lightweight Miter Saw.</p>
<p>You'll also need to look at how much you'll be using your Miter saw. If you only need it for one small weekend job, then renting one or buying a <strong>used miter saw</strong> may be the answer rather than buying a new one. This is also true if you'll only use it a few times per year. </p>
<p>If you want bevel or compound cuts, however, you will want to get the more advanced Compound Miter Saws. These tilt the blade in a way that makes these cuts possible. If you want the blade to tilt in either direction (so you won't have to turn the material your cutting so often), then a Dual-Lever model will be right for you.</p>
<p>Next, think about how large the materials you are cutting will be. While a ten-inch model works for most people, you may want a twelve-inch blade if you plan to be cutting larger materials. You may even want a smaller blade size than ten inches, if you prefer to have precise cutting on smaller pieces. Keep in mind that the larger sizes generally cost significantly more.</p>
<p>Finally, you should consider if you would rather have a corded or cordless model. Plug-in saws are generally going to run forever, of course, but they lack the convenience of being able to easily carry your saw around without worrying about plugs. If you plan to be working on a site or a project for a long period at one time, even the models with larger batteries might run out. You could consider buying extra batteries or foregoing the cordless models altogether if you don't want to bother worrying about a battery.</p>
<p>Those are the basic considerations to think about when choosing a Miter Saw. Of course, there are all sorts of features and bells-and-whistles that some Miter Saws might have as well. For instance, some Compound Saws come with a sliding head that makes it much easier to cut through wide materials. You'll also want to make sure the guides and indexes on you saw are easy to read during operation.</p>
<p>If you plan to be switching out blades very often, some models have systems that make taking out and installing blades pretty easy. An electric brake will ensure that the blade stops just after you release the trigger, which makes cutting a bit more safe. Finally, some come with dust ports that allow you to collect the sawdust as you cut.</p>
<p>These are some things to consider when you are wondering <strong>how to choose a Miter Saw</strong>. If you think about what you need before you buy, you will less likely be unhappy with your purchase.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>In these days of extreme weather and blackouts in the news, more and more people are buying backup generators. Needless to say, there's been an influxe of <strong>cheap generators</strong> that have hit the market. 3000 and 4000 watt generators that use to cost a thousand bucks or more can now be found for less than $500. Some way cheaper than that. But are cheap generators worth the price or should you save more money and get a name brand power generator?</p>
<p>There's one side of the fence that says generators are generators so you might as well buy the cheapest you can get. After all, why should you spend a thousand bucks to get a 4000 watt generator when you can get one for $300?</p>
<p>Some of the people who say this are just naive and do not understand why some things are priced more than others. I mean, isn't a Ford Escort just as good as a Cadillac? They both have 4 wheels, an egine and a tranny...right? So why pay more for a Cadillac?</p>
<p>Others are just cheap and look for the lowest price no matter what.</p>
<h3>Cheap Generators have their place, but is it at your home?</h3>
<p>There are many reason some generators are cheap while others may cost as much as 5 times the price. Now I'm usually the one that will spend the extra money and get a reliable product. I hate wasting money on anything. I'm a frugal person if there was ever one. But I also realize that there is a reason why some products are cheaper than others.</p>
<p>For one, some of the cheap generators come from foreign countries such as China where the quality control may not be as strict as it could be. It's no secret that China and some other countries do not use the best materials and use cheap labor. Also, many of these Companies that produce products are subsidized by the Government, so actually making a profit isn't high on the list as it is in Countries that don't subsidize their companies.</p>
<h3>When Is A Cheap Generator A Good Deal?</h3>
<p>Now I understand that some people live on a budget. I'm one also. But I will say there are times when a cheap generator may be perfect for some households. For example, if you plan on keeping a generator in the Garage for emergencies like a Hurricane or other natural disaster, then a cheap generator may be a perfect option for you.</p>
<p>Or maybe you just want one to take along on those rare family camping trips to the lake. In that case, a cheap generator may also fit the bill. You can get small generators that will run a lot of small appliances for around $200 to $300.</p>
<p>Some of these will also be large enough to run small power tools on remote worksites or at the family cabin.</p>
<p>Basically, if you plan to use a cheap generator only occassionally, then it may be a good deal for you.</p>
<h3>When Isn't A Cheap Generator A Good Deal?</h3>
<p>I myself would never depend on a cheap generator to supply power for my family in case of a natural disaster. During Hurricane Ike, our home was without power for nearly two weeks in 90 degree + temps.  I was so thankful that I had bought a Honda generator big enough to run the necessary appliances just for a scenario like this.</p>
<p>Also, after about 4 days, people started showing up from out of state with cheap chinese generators. Generators that once were selling for $300 and $400 were all of a sudden fetching $1500 or more. Needless to say, people were willing to pay a lot of money for cheap generators. In fact, many could have gotten small diesel generators or top of the line Honda generators before the storm for the same price they paid for the cheap ones!</p>
<p>Also, whenever you families safety will be at risk, your money is better spent on a better quality generator like a Honda or comparable generator.</p>
<p>If you plan on using your generator on a routine basis, then you may want to go for a reliable model rather than the cheapest generator you can find.  Especially if your income depends on it. Few things are worse than having a generator crap out on you in the middle of a job.</p>
<p>One more reason a cheap generator may cost you more money on down the line.</p>
<p>So if you think you can afford <strong>cheap generators</strong>, make sure you sit down and think long and hard before running out and finding the cheapest generator you can find. Make sure it fits your needs and that you won't be at risk should it fail you. Otherwise, if cheap is what you want, I say go for it!</p>
